Q:   Which major specializations are available at Sinhgad College of Engineering?
A: 
Sinhgad College of Engineering offers Degree courses including 12 UG and 15 PG courses. These programs are offerred in Full Time mode. Sinhgad College of Engineering has specializations such as B.Tech specializations in Mechanical Engineering, Computer Science Engineering, Telecommunication Engineering, Information Technology, Civil Engineering, Production Engineering, Chemical Engineering, Biotechnology Engineering, Electronics Engineering, M.E./M.Tech specializations in Chemical Engineering, Communications Engineering, Computer Science Engineering, Information Technology, Electrical Engineering, VLSI Design, Environmental Engineering, Mechatronics Engineering, Structural Engineering.

Q:   Can I get a seat for M.Tech programme at DR DY Patil Institute of Technology Pune?
A: 

Yes, the candidates can obtain a seat in the M.Tech courses based on their performance in the accepted entrance exam at Dr DY Patil Institute of Technology Pune. The university provides over 70 seats for its M.Tech programmes. Interested candidates need to fill out the application before the set deadline so that they do not miss any updates. However, it must be noted that the mentioned seat intake is as per the official website. It may vary and, hence, is indicative.

Q:   How can I get admission to ME at TSSM's Bhivarabai Sawant College of Engineering and Research?
A: 

For admission to the ME course, students need to fulfil the minimum eligibility criteria in the first place. TSSM's Bhivarabai Sawant College of Engineering and Research accepts a valid score on the GATE, MHTCET MTech, GPAT exam. Apart from this, the total tuition fee for the ME course is INR 1.46 lakh.

Q:   How many students can do M.Tech at PVPIT Pune?
A: 

Padmabhooshan Vasantdada Patil Institute of Technology (PVPIT) Pune offers degree courses in UG and PG with multiple specilizations. Students who wants to continue their studies and do Masters degree from PVPIT must fulfill the eligibility criteria and then apply. PVPIT allots a total of 108 seats in M.Tech.

Firstly, Aspirants need to go through the criteria set by the institute, then score a qualifying marks in the entrance exam i.e. GATE, MHTCET M.Tech. After that shortlisted candidates will be called for counselling or interview and then selected candidates will be alloted seat as per the ranking. As many students can apply for M.Tech at PVPIT Pune but those will get selected who qualify the selection process.

Q:   Does IIAEIT Pune offers M.Tech course?
A: 

Yes, IIAEIT Pune does offer M.Tech course for two-years. The institute also offers BTech + M.Tech course for the duration of five-years, and divided into ten semesters. The eligibility for admissions into theses courses depends on the scores achieved in SPACE PGCET/ GATE. 

Q:   Can I get direct admission to Pune University?
A: 

SPPU admission for a majority of PG and UG courses, such as M.Sc. M.A. M.Tech, M.Com B.A. And BBA among others, is based on the Online Entrance Exam (OEE) conducted by the University. Additionally, there are numerous courses, such as MCA MMM, Advanced Diploma, MPH E-MBA, LL. M. and M. Lib. ISC among others, where the admission process is completely based on merit in the previous qualifying exam (Class 12 for UG admission and UG degree for PG admission). Thus, students will not be able to get direct admissions to Pune University.

Q:   Does DY Patil University Pune have an active placement cell?
A: 

Yes, DY Patil University Pune has an active placement cell, known by the name of Office of Career Services. Two platforms, namely CIAP (Centre for Industry and Academia Partnerships) and Centre for Excellence KRITI are also established to promote innovation-driven environment at the campus. These two platforms are designed for bridging the gap between the University and companies with the objective of developing future skills, research work and final placement drives.

Q:   Are there any specializations offered by Imperial College of Engineering and Research?
A: 
Imperial College of Engineering and Research offers Degree courses including 4 UG and 6 PG courses. These programs are offerred in Full Time mode. Imperial College of Engineering and Research has specializations such as B.Tech specializations in Civil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, Electronics Engineering, Computer Science Engineering, M.E./M.Tech specializations in Structural Engineering, Signal Processing, Mechanical Engineering, Construction Engineering, Computer Science Engineering.
